Dakine is an American outdoor company specializing in sportswear and equipment for various boardsports. The brand was founded by Rob Kaplan in 1979 in Hawaii. Initially produced only equipment and accessories for surfing lovers, but in 1989 began production of innovative and high-quality boardsports accessories and became world leader in this field.
Dakine is famous for kite harnesses, windsurf harnesses, waterwear, backpacks and a wide range of accessories.
